Revealed to the general public more than a decade ago in the show On n'demande qu'àgrave; en rire on France 2. Artus has today become an essential face of the French comedy scene. But also of the big screen. As a reminder, his first film as a director, called Un p'tit truc en plus, exceeded the 10 million entrances in theaters during its 2024 release.
Monday, February 3, 2025, Artus was on the set of the show Quotidien alongside Sayyid El Alami and Amaury Foucher. In order to promote his next film. Entitled La Pampa, this feature film is due to be released in theaters on Wednesday, February 5, 2025. “Having Artus inLa Pampa, we think it's a big plus for the film“, Yann Barthès said.

Artus: the director of his next film “lost 100,000 euros” because of him
“Yes, there are financiers who are… But because it's still this thing of these two families of cinema. Comedy and arthouse cinema. Where we don't have the right to mix and all that. And so yes, there was a financier who had put in 100,000 euros. For a budget like this film, which is 2 million euros, it's huge. When Antoine (the director, editor's note) said I was in the film. He said, if there is Artus, I will withdraw, because it is not his cinema, it is not his thing“, Artus revealed in particular.
“And Antoine said, but there will be Artus. Because that's it, he is a friend, we love each other very much. And I think he likes me as an actor. I hope so. And so, he withdrew, he lost 100,000 euros, but he got me. But that was before the release of Un p'tit truc en plus. So there, I think that the financier suddenly… It was before, after he was happy. There, as they say…“, the comedian then concluded.
